About 3 Drill Street
3 Drill Street is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Keighley (BD21 3DN). It has a recorded floor area of 97 m² (around 1044 sq ft) and council tax band A. The latest certificate (June 2018) shows a C (score 75), near the top of the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 85). Other recorded features include a basement.
At 97 m² the property is well over the postcode median (72 m² across 9 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Across 2003–2023, sale prices on this property compounded at 3.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£109,000 sits 108% above the 2023 sale of £52,400.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£50/sq ft) was about 40.1% above the typical sold price in the postcode. One planning record on file: new windows approved in 2014. Past consents include new windows,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Last sale on file: £52,400 in August 2023.
